The geometry of the moduli space of one-dimensional sheaves

Abstract
Let be the moduli space of stable sheaves on with Hilbert polynomial . In this paper, we determine the effective and the nef cone of the space by natural geometric divisors. Main idea is to use the wall-crossing on the space of Bridgeland stability conditions and to compute the intersection numbers of divisors with curves by using the Grothendieck-Riemann-Roch theorem. We also present the stable base locus decomposition of the space . As a byproduct, we obtain the Betti numbers of the moduli spaces, which confirm the prediction in physics.
